Output 42799a0c683a6378ebf1ed3514b1619078ba8dd45d798fc4b24f8622c65d25f6:0

value
11576696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ec6143bb622026e91e784d1c23b66a195002f7fc OP_EQUAL
address
3PEsuspn9r79Kk7zUZXrdhMUDamrP6QMS8
transaction
42799a0c683a6378ebf1ed3514b1619078ba8dd45d798fc4b24f8622c65d25f6
confirmations
269929
spent
true